What is Squad Betting?

Squad betting refers to placing wagers on teams or groups, often called ‘squads,’ in various competitive arenas. Unlike individual player bets, squad betting focuses on collective performance, making it ideal for sports like football, where team dynamics play a crucial role. In esports, it’s particularly popular due to the squad-based nature of games involving coordinated teams.

Types of Squad Bets

There are several bet types within squad betting: match winners, where you predict the victorious squad; over/under bets on total points or kills; and prop bets on specific squad achievements, like first blood in esports. Each type offers unique opportunities, but they all require a deep understanding of team compositions and strategies.

Effective Strategies for Squad Betting

To succeed in squad betting, you need more than luck; strategic analysis is key. Start by researching team histories, player synergies, and recent performances. For instance, in soccer, analyze how a squad performs against similar opponents, considering factors like home advantage or injuries.

Analyzing Team Dynamics

Focus on squad cohesion. In esports, watch for communication styles and role distributions— a well-balanced squad with strong support players often outperforms star-heavy lineups. Use statistical tools to evaluate win rates and head-to-head records. Practical tip: Maintain a betting journal to track patterns and refine your approach over time.

Bankroll Management

Never risk more than 1-2% of your bankroll on a single squad bet. This conservative strategy preserves your funds during losing streaks. Additionally, diversify bets across different squads and leagues to mitigate risks. Expert insight: Seasoned bettors often employ the Kelly Criterion formula to optimize bet sizes based on perceived value.

Leveraging Data and Analytics

Incorporate data analytics for an edge. Tools like performance metrics from past games can predict outcomes. For example, in basketball squad betting, metrics such as offensive efficiency and defensive ratings are invaluable. Actionable advice: Follow expert analyses on forums and podcasts to stay updated on squad form and meta changes in esports.

Betting Strategy Pros Cons Best For
Match Winner Simple and direct Lower odds Beginners
Over/Under Focuses on totals Requires stats knowledge Analysts
Prop Bets High excitement Higher risk Experienced bettors
Parlay Bets Big payouts Low success rate Risk-takers

This comparison table highlights key squad betting strategies, helping you choose based on your expertise level.
